NANJEMOY AND EAGLE HARBOR, MD — Congressman Steny H. Hoyer (MD-05) met with leaders from YESS! of Charles County and Eagle Harbor town government to discuss how over $800,000 in federal grants made possible by President Biden’s Investing in America agenda is expanding clean water access for rural families in Nanjemoy and cleaning up legacy pollution in Eagle Harbor.
SOUTHERN MARYLAND — This week, Congressman Steny H. Hoyer (MD-05) received a briefing and tour at two airports in Southern Maryland – Maryland Airport in Charles County and St. Mary’s Regional Airport in St. Mary’s County. As part of the Regional Leadership Council’s Investing in America Week of Action, Congressman Hoyer met with airport officials and leaders from St. Mary’s County to discuss how federal funding from the Bipartisan Infrastructure Law is improving safety and upgrading transportation infrastructure in Southern Maryland.
BRANDYWINE, MD — Congressman Steny H. Hoyer met with pharmacists and medical providers at Greater Baden Medical Services during the Regional Leadership Council’s Investing in America Week of Action to discuss the transformational health care savings made possible by the Inflation Reduction Act (IRA) and American Rescue Plan (ARP). As Majority Leader, Congressman Hoyer worked closely with President Biden and House Democrats to bring both the IRA and ARP to the House Floor.
WASHINGTON, DC — Congressman Steny H. Hoyer (MD-05), U.S. Senators Chris Van Hollen (D-MD) and Ben Cardin (D-MD) and Congressmen Dutch Ruppersberger (MD-02), John Sarbanes (MD-03), Kweisi Mfume (MD-07), Andy Harris (MD-01), Jamie Raskin (MD-08), David Trone (MD-06), and Glenn Ivey (MD-04) today announced $3.5 million in U.S. Department of Labor’s emergency National Dislocated Worker Grant funds to create temporary clean up and recovery jobs for workers impacted by the tragic collapse of Baltimore’s Francis Scott Key Bridge.
